I recently finished a letterpress project for my cousin and dear friend and I had such a great time working with her. Caitlin and I first decided the color scheme for the wedding and then went onto designing her Save-the-Dates. She’s getting married at a historical inn in New England and she really wanted a vintage feeling conveyed. I found an old sleigh ride illustration and redrew it (complete with top hats for the men in the sleigh!) and matched it with a hand-drawn antique serif for the type. We went with a colonial blue ink and envelope, and finished it with hand-cut oatmeal and cream liners. I had such a nice time working on these, I can’t wait to start designing and printing Cait & Alex’s wedding invitations!
